Created in 1686 by Zanabazar, a Mongolian polymath — Buddhist scholar, artist, and physician. The first Soyombo symbol (☸) became the national symbol now featured on Mongolia's flag and coat of arms. Zanabazar was the defining figure of the Mongolian renaissance, equally accomplished in sculpture, painting, and medicine.
